Purpose of role

Within the framework of the hotel strategy, this person is in charge to implement and use Revenue Management (RM) methods, processes, tools in one or several hotel(s) in order to maximize the turnover.

Key Accountabilities include:

- Support the hotel Management to define the hotel strategy (in terms of business mix and pricing by season and type of day) for the future periods –the initial annual forecast
- Analyse hotel results and performance (average rates, occupancy rates, RevPAR). Survey the market and competitors in terms of performance (RevPARIndex, market penetration…), pricing and availability as a basis for future tactical decisions with the Hotel General Managers.
- Ensure an accurate and dynamic forecast for the future dates (by room and revenue by segment and day) based on the Revenue Management (RM) referenced systems recommendations and a daily monitoring of the data (portfolio, booking pick-up, events, calendar events).
- Take daily decisions to optimize the hotel turnover. Decisions in terms of pricing, inventory management (RMLs open/close), group quotation, distribution channels. Ensure that recommendations are implemented in reservation and reception, and that systems (PMS, TARS, RMS) are updated accordingly.
- Ensure that a “RM culture” is spread in the hotel, through the animation of weekly revenue meetings (gathering the General Manager and the key hotel managers) and regular coaching and training sessions for the hotel teams
